相关文章
【C++11】Lambda 表达式:基本使用 和 底层原理
文章目录 Lambda 表达式1. 不考虑捕捉列表1.1 简单使用介绍1.2 简单使用举例 2. 捕捉列表 [ ] 和 mutable 关键字2.1 使用方法传值捕捉传引用捕捉 2.2 捕捉方法一览2.3 使用举例 3. lambda 的底层分析 Lambda 表达式
书写格式:
[capture_list](parameters) mutabl…
建站知识
2024/11/28 20:33:05
EasyX图形库note4,动画及键盘交互
大家好,这里是Dark Flame Master,专栏从这篇开始就会变得很有意思,我们可以利用今天所学的只是实现很多功能,同样为之后的更加好玩的内容打下基础,从这届开始将会利用所学的知识制作一些小游戏,废话不多说&…
建站知识
2024/11/28 20:41:34
黑马JVM总结(二十五)
(1)字节码指令-cinit
构造方法可以分为两类,一类是cinit 一类init
cinit是整个类的构造方法 putstatic:进行static变量的赋值,是到常量池里找到名字一个叫做i的变量 (2)字节码指令-init
in…
建站知识
2024/10/8 5:37:09
Swift data范围截取问题
文章目录 一、截取字符串的几种方法1. 截取前几位2. 截取后几位3. subData4. 下标截取 二、subData(in:) 报错 EXC_BREAKPOINT 一、截取字符串的几种方法
1. 截取前几位
mobileID.prefix(32)2. 截取后几位
mobileID.suffix(3)3. subData
data.subdata(in: 0..<4)4. 下标…
建站知识
2024/11/9 2:17:47
深度学习基础之参数量(3)
一般的CNN网络的参数量估计代码
class ResidualBlock(nn.Module):def __init__(self, in_planes, planes, norm_fngroup, stride1):super(ResidualBlock, self).__init__()print(in_planes, planes, norm_fn, stride)self.conv1 nn.Conv2d(in_planes, planes, kernel_size3, …
建站知识
2024/11/27 13:11:36
C/C++笔试面试真题
C/C++笔试面试真题
已经更新到 45 题了
1、堆和栈的区别 1、栈由系统自动分配,而堆是人为申请开辟; 2、栈获得的空间较小,而堆获得的空间较大; 3、栈由系统自动分配,速度较快,而堆一般速度比较慢; 4、栈是连续的空间,而堆是不连续的空间。 2、什么是野指针?产生的的…
建站知识
2024/10/8 5:37:15
LetCode刷题[简单题](1)刷手续费
int maxProfit(vector<int>& prices, int fee) {int n prices.size(); // 获取股票价格数组的长度if (n 0) {return 0; // 如果数组为空,返回0,因为没有交易可以进行}int buy -prices[0]; // 初始化持有股票的最大利润为第一天的股票价格的…
建站知识
2024/10/8 5:37:17
QT的QCommand的do和undo介绍
QT的QCommand的介绍 在Qt中,QCommand类是一个抽象类,它提供了redo()和undo()方法的纯虚函数,用于执行重做和撤销操作。QCommand类的目的是提供一种通用的方式来表示和执行命令式操作,这些操作可以是用户交互、程序逻辑或其他类型的…
建站知识
2024/11/23 20:30:18